About the artwork
Hans Malmberg had a long and prosperous career in press photography and photo journalism. He travelled the world as a freelancer, mainly for the illustrated magazine Se throughout most of the 1950s, and later for the Co-operative Union’s magazine Vi. His books cover subjects such as Swedish parishes, Dalälven river, Iceland, and “The Wonderful Adventures of Nils”, Selma Lagerlöf’s epic story for early-20th century school children. One of his most famous photo journalistic essays is from the Korean war in 1950, chronicling the lives of American soldiers and the suffering of the local population. In 1958, Malmberg joined the group Tio fotografer, one of Sweden’s most renowned photographer collectives with a shared studio in Stockholm.
